IN RE LUMSDEN

No. 14-09-00271-CV.

291 S.W.3d 456 (2009)

In re Alan B. LUMSDEN, M.D., Relator.

Court of Appeals of Texas, Houston (14th Dist.).

Rehearing Overruled September 3, 2009.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Thomas P. Sartwelle, N. Terry Adams, Jr., Houston, for relator.

Jimmy Williamson and Cindy M. Rusnak, for Beverly Shepherd-Sherman.

Jimmy Williamson, Cindy M. Rusnak, Dwight Willis Scott, Lisa Lynne Turboff, James R. Boston, Oscar Luis Delarosa, Kenneth E. Broughton, Carolyn C. Smith, Christopher Dean Demeo, Stephanie Laird Tolson, Houston, for appellees.

Panel consists of Chief Justice HEDGES and Justices ANDERSON and SEYMORE.


OPINION

ADELE HEDGES, Justice.

On March 26, 2009, relator, Alan B. Lumsden, M.D., filed a petition for writ of mandamus. In his petition, relator requests that we compel the respondent, the Honorable Patricia Hancock, presiding judge of the 113th District Court of Harris County, to set aside her March 3, 2009 order denying his request to stay discovery pending resolution of a related interlocutory appeal in this...
